Hansen’s Signature All Natural Sarsaprilla Soda

March 22, 2000
Filed under: sarsaparilla reviews — anthony @ 5:45 pm
Type: Sarsaparilla Comes In: 14oz glass bottle
Available: CT, NJ, NY, online Obtained in: Quik Chek, NJ
Head: Large Sweetener: cane sugar, honey
Caffeine: No
Website: http://www.hansens.com

from the get go, you know this soda is wacky. the bottle is strange looking, it is 14 ounces instead of the usual 12. then you see it has a “blend of Madagascan, Indonesian and Tahitian Vanilla Extracts.” what the heck is that about?! at first, i always enjoy this soda. it is very full bodied, you can taste the honey and vanilla distinctly. yet, as i drain more and more of it, i always feel a little sick. it is too rich perhaps. i do not know. not that it is a bad sick always, sometimes it is kind of nice. overall, it is not really a sarsaparilla but more of a creamy, rich root beer.
Anthony’s Rating: 79

Boylan’s Root Beer

March 18, 2000
Filed under: root beer reviews — anthony @ 9:12 pm
Type: Root Beer Comes In: 12oz glass bottle
Available: AZ, CA, CT, DE, GA, IL, IN, MD, MA, MI, MN, MO, NV, NJ, NM, NY, NC, OH, OK, OR, PA, VA, WA, WI, online Obtained in: Bridgewater, NJ
Head: Medium Sweetener: cane sugar
Caffeine: No
Website: http://www.boylanbottling.com/

sadly, this does not at all live up to their birch beers. the cane sugar and the yucca extract in this combine for a weird taste. it is not a very good taste. it is bearable and decent if you drink it with a meal or something but by itself it is not something i would pick to have often. very unfortunate since this probably the only really bad soda i have had from this NJ bottleworks.
Anthony’s Rating: 60

Crystal Club Draft Style Root Beer

March 11, 2000
Filed under: root beer reviews — anthony @ 3:01 pm
Type: Root Beer Comes In: 12 oz can
Available: PA Obtained in: Wilkes Barre, PA
Head: Medium Sweetener: corn sweetener
Caffeine: No

not what i expected so much. has 4 ingredients (carbonated water, corn sweeteners, root beer flavor, carmel color) but it has a pretty bold and distinct flavor. kind of licquorice-y but not in a harsh way like many others do. very carbonated though and beyond that licquorice flavor it is not amazing. good, but it makes you burp a whole load. so i’d get some more since it is quite cheap, but i wouldn’t base a lifestyle on it.
Anthony’s Rating: 54
